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5246751 0754340 2687549 237643232
0879800 754
0879800 754
31996 59 412572728
All about undefined
Interested in learning more?
0879800 754
31996 59 412572728
See more
77759358 03973715298
16314563 517902161 617
See more
888036115 15243816633
354828 7495937 27360956393 95110 011
See more